What is Amazon Wholesale?

When you sell wholesale on Amazon, you buy products in large amounts at a discounted price and then resell them individually on Amazon at a marked-up price. Wholesale differs from private label selling, where sellers create their own branded products. With wholesale, you are wrestling well-established brands that are already known and in demand, removing the need for branding and product development.

Benefits of Selling Wholesale on Amazon

Selling wholesale on Amazon offers a lot of advantages, especially for people looking for a low-risk and adaptable business model. These are some key benefits:

  • Establish Brand Trust: Reselling well-established brands eliminates the need to build customer trust. Consumers are already familiar with the products you are selling, which makes it easier to drive sales without a lot of marketing.
  • Lower Risk: Wholesale sellers benefit from selling products that are already successful, unlike private label products, where there is uncertainty about whether a new product will perform well. You know there’s demand, so the risk of product failure is significantly smaller.
  • Scalability: Once you have a reliable supplier, it is easy to scale up your operations by buying larger amounts and expanding your product range.
  • Amazon’s FBA (Fulfillment by Amazon): When you sell wholesale on Amazon, you can take advantage of the FBA program, which means Amazon handles shipping, returns, and customer service. This saves you a lot of time and effort while also making your products eligible for Amazon Prime’s fast shipping.

How to Get Started With Amazon Wholesale

Here is a guide to help get you started:

1. Set Up Your Amazon Seller Account

You will need to create an Amazon Seller Central account before you can start selling wholesale on the site. This will allow you to list products, manage inventory, and track sales. It is important to choose a Professional Selling Plan, which costs $39.99 per month, as it lets you sell more than 40 products per month.

2. Research Products and Niches

One of the most important steps in the wholesale selling process is choosing the right products to sell. You want to select products that have strong demand, good profit margins, and low competition. Some websites have certain tools that can help you understand the competitive landscape, analyze product performance, and find trending niches. It is usually a good idea to focus on products with an existing consumer base while avoiding overly saturated product categories where there is a lot of competition from established sellers.

3. Find Wholesalers and Distributors

Once you have found a product, you will need to source it from trustworthy suppliers. You can look for wholesalers online through different directories or directly contact manufacturers to ask about the distribution terms and bulk pricing. It is also important to establish relationships with reliable suppliers that offer competitive pricing. It is essential to ask for product samples first to make sure the quality is good before buying a large quantity.

4. Negotiate Terms and Pricing

It is vital to negotiate the best possible terms for your business when dealing with wholesalers or distributors, which includes pricing, shipping fees, payment terms, and minimum order quantities. You want to get prices that leave enough room for profit after accounting for Amazon’s fees, shipping costs, and other expenses. Do not be afraid to negotiate, as most suppliers expect it, and it can lead to better deals that benefit your bottom line.

5. List Your Products on Amazon

Once you have got your products from a wholesaler, it is time to list them on Amazon. If the product already exists on the website, you can list your items under the existing listing by choosing the “Select on Amazon” option. Choosing this option makes the process easier since you won’t need to create a new listing from scratch. If the product does not have an existing listing, however, you will need to create one. Make sure you provide high-quality images, use relevant keywords, and write a persuasive product description to help your product appear in search results.

6. Optimize Pricing and Inventory

Pricing is an important part of succeeding in the wholesale model. You’ll want to price competitively while making sure you still make a profit. One approach is using repricing tools to automatically adjust your prices based on market shifts and competitors’ prices. Managing your inventory is just as important as Amazon penalizes sellers who consistently run out of stock, so make sure you have enough inventory. Using Amazon’s FBA will also help; Amazon will inform you when stock is running low.

7. Leverage Amazon’s FBA

The Fulfillment by Amazon (FBA) program lets you store your products in Amazon’s warehouses, where they will handle the shipping, returns, and customer service. This program is a huge help for many wholesale sellers, as it lessens the operational load and makes your products eligible for Amazon Prime’s fast shipping. FBA also expands the visibility of your products, as Amazon usually prioritizes FBA sellers in search results.

Common Challenges and How to Overcome Them

While selling wholesale on Amazon offers a lot of advantages, there are also some challenges. Here are some common problems wholesale sellers face and how to overcome them:

  • Competition: You will frequently be competing with other sellers, including Amazon itself. Using certain tools to find low-competition niches and pricing tools to stay competitive and give you an edge. 
  • Finding Reliable Suppliers: Not all suppliers are the same. Some may offer low prices but have lower-quality items. Always assess your suppliers carefully and build long-term relationships with the ones that meet your standards.
  • Cash Flow Management: Buying in bulk requires a large upfront investment, and it may take time before you start seeing profits. Managing cash flow effectively and avoiding overextending on inventory will help keep your business operating smoothly.

Is Selling on Amazon Right for You?

Selling wholesale on Amazon is a great option for many entrepreneurs, as it is scalable, has fewer risks than other e-commerce models, and allows you to utilize well-established brands. However, to make it successful, it requires a good amount of research, careful inventory management, and relationship-building with suppliers. If you are willing to put in the effort to find trustworthy suppliers and manage the logistics, wholesale selling can generate a profitable income stream.
